The Glycerol Ester of Wood Rosin Market size was estimated at USD 460.70 million in 2025 and expected to reach USD 484.57 million in 2026, at a CAGR of 5.25% to reach USD 659.40 million by 2032.

Understanding the market through segmentation proves essential for identifying high-potential application areas and tailoring product development efforts. When examined by end-use industry, formulations in adhesive and sealant technologies reveal robust demand for superior tack properties, especially within pressure-sensitive labels and packaging solutions. In the food and beverage arena, glycerol ester of wood rosin serves as a critical emulsifier in carbonated drinks, fruit juices, and sauces and dressings, enhancing flavor stability and visual clarity. Meanwhile, in personal care, its compatibility with lipid-based ingredients lends itself to premium lipstick and lotion formulations, where sensory appeal and shelf-life stability are paramount. The pharmaceutical sector further leverages multiple functionality in syrups, tablets, and topical preparations, balancing solubility and bioavailability requirements.
From an application perspective, this versatile additive performs dual roles as an emulsifier and stabilizer, ensuring uniform dispersion of immiscible phases in complex systems. Its physical state, whether offered in liquid form for ease of incorporation or solid form for extended shelf stability, influences handling preferences and processing parameters. Purity grade also plays a vital role, with food-grade esters meeting stringent safety criteria, industrial-grade variants prioritizing cost-effective performance, and pharmaceutical-grade materials conforming to the highest pharmacopoeial standards. Distribution channels complete the picture, as direct sales engagements facilitate customized formulations, distributors grant broad market reach, and online platforms offer convenience and rapid replenishment. Regional dynamics significantly influence how glycerol ester of wood rosin is sourced, formulated, and consumed. In the Americas, the presence of major forest resources and established forestry sectors underpins a reliable domestic supply chain, while a robust manufacturing infrastructure supports both adhesive producers and beverage industry giants. Shifts toward bio-based ingredients in North American formulations have further driven growth, positioning the region as a leader in sustainable practices.
Across Europe, the Middle East, and Africa, stringent regulatory frameworks around food additives and cosmetics drive demand for high-purity ester grades. European producers are at the forefront of developing low-impact processing technologies, responding to consumer advocacy for eco-friendly products. In parallel, increasing packaging innovation in Middle Eastern markets and expanding beverage sectors in North Africa have created new downstream opportunities for this versatile ingredient.
Meanwhile, Asia-Pacific continues to be an innovation hotbed, as rapidly expanding personal care brands and pharmaceutical manufacturers seek advanced additives to differentiate product offerings. Emerging economies in Southeast Asia are investing in local esterification facilities, aiming to reduce reliance on imports and improve supply chain resilience. Additionally, evolving distribution networks-spanning specialty chemical distributors, direct partnerships, and e-commerce platforms-enable faster market entry and tailored service models across the region.
